Neglecting Additional Expenses Past the Purchase Cost

Real Estate Tax and Insurance Coverage
While you've most likely allocated for the purchase price of your new home, it's important not to ignore the ongoing prices of real estate tax and insurance policy. These expenditures can greatly impact your monthly budget plan. Property taxes vary based upon place and home value, so study your location's rates to avoid shocks. Don't neglect home owner's insurance, which secures your investment from unanticipated events like fire or burglary. Lenders commonly need insurance protection, so factor it right into your general prices. You might additionally wish to consider extra protection for all-natural calamities, depending upon your region. By comprehending these ongoing expenses, you'll be much better prepared to handle your funds and appreciate your new home without unexpected monetary stress.
Repair And Maintenance Costs
Several novice home purchasers take too lightly the relevance of budgeting for upkeep and fixing expenditures, which can promptly accumulate after relocating. It's not just the acquisition cost that matters; there are recurring expenses you need to take into consideration. Homes call for regular maintenance, from lawn like plumbing fixings. You might encounter unexpected issues like a dripping roofing or defective home appliances, which can strike your purse hard. Specialists recommend reserving 1% to 3% of your home's value every year for maintenance. This method, you're planned for both regular and surprise expenses. OC Home Buyers. Don't let these prices catch you unsuspecting-- element them right into your spending plan to assure a smoother shift right into homeownership.
Avoiding the Home Loan Pre-Approval Process
Often, first-time home buyers neglect the relevance of getting pre-approved for a home loan before beginning their home search. This step isn't simply a procedure; it's crucial for specifying your budget and improving your search. Without pre-approval, you take the chance of falling in love with a home you can't manage, losing time and energy.
Pre-approval provides you a clear idea of just how much you can obtain, making you a much more eye-catching customer. Sellers commonly choose offers from pre-approved customers since it reveals you're serious and financially all set.
Furthermore, missing this action can bring about hold-ups later on. When you locate a home you like, you'll intend to act swiftly, and having your funds figured out ahead of time can make all the distinction. Ignoring the Importance of a Home Assessment
When you're acquiring a home, missing the evaluation can be a pricey error. A thorough inspection exposes possible issues and helps you recognize the residential or commercial property's true condition. Do not ignore this crucial step; it can conserve you from unanticipated fixings down the line.
Recognizing Assessment Conveniences
While it might be tempting to miss a home inspection to conserve time or cash, doing so can bring about expensive surprises down the road. this article A detailed examination helps you uncover potential issues with the residential property that you might not discover throughout a walkthrough. You'll get insight into the home's condition, consisting of the roofing, pipes, and electrical systems. This knowledge equips you to negotiate repairs or readjust your deal based on the findings. Additionally, an evaluation can offer comfort, ensuring you're making an audio financial investment. Bear in mind, a tiny upfront expense for an examination can conserve you from substantial expenses in the future. It's an essential step in your home-buying trip that you should not overlook.

Regularly Asked Inquiries
Just How Can I Boost My Credit History Prior To Purchasing a Home?
To boost your credit report prior to getting a home, pay for existing debts, make settlements in a timely manner, restrict brand-new credit report queries, and check your debt report for mistakes. These actions can significantly boost your score.
What Types of Mortgages Are Offered for First-Time Buyers?
As a newbie customer, you'll discover several home loan kinds available, like fixed-rate, adjustable-rate, FHA, and VA lendings. Each choice has one-of-a-kind benefits, so review your financial situation to choose the best fit for you.
Should I Function With a Property Agent or Do It Myself?
You ought to most definitely think about dealing with a realty representative. They've obtained the experience and resources to navigate the market, discuss better bargains, and conserve you time, making the home-buying process smoother and a lot more effective.
The length of time Does the Home Purchasing Process Generally Take?
The home buying process usually takes around 30 to 60 days once you have actually made an offer. However, factors like funding and evaluations can extend this timeline, so it's finest to remain prepared and flexible.
What Are Closing Costs, and Exactly How Much Should I Anticipate to Pay?
Closing prices are fees due at the home purchase's end, including lending origination, evaluation, and title insurance coverage. You need to expect to pay about 2% to 5% of the home's rate in shutting costs.
